Antique Fine Quality Inlaid Burr Walnut Bonheur De Jour Desk Writing Table

About the Item

Antique fine quality inlaid burr walnut Bonheur de Jour bureau desk writing table 19th Century. Veneer on mahogany construction, very heavy and strong. Drop well bureau compartment with patinated tooled leather writing surface. The mirrored glass is in good order with only light oxidation. Attractive marquetry inlays and ormolu brass mount decoration. No loose joints and no woodworm. Full of character and charm. A rare and attractive quality find. The drawers slide freely. Would look great in the right location! We have keys to the glass compartments and fall front. Overall maximum dimensions: 89cmW x 54cmD x 141cmH (71 - 75cmH knee hole). In very good antique condition with minor historic knocks, marks, cracks, scratches, repairs, wear and imperfections. Age an patina to the veneers with some minor losses and repairs, which add to the authenticity and charm. Stock No. 8107.
